How much is 750ml of champagne?
750 milliliters (25 ounces) is roughly equal to 25 fluid ounces, including Bubbly. Five champagne glasses can be served generously from a bottle, depending on the size of Champagne flutes.

How many glasses of wine are in a 750ml bottle?
5 glasses
Standard Bottle – A standard bottle of wine is 750ml, or 25 fluid ounces, and will net you about 5 glasses of wine. Magnum Bottle – A magnum bottle of wine is 1.5L, or 50 ounces (double the standard), so you will be able to get about 10 glass of wine from this bottle.

How much is Moet champagne?
Moët & Chandon prices vary depending on the bottle. The cheapest bottles of Moët & Chandon start at around $50 per 750ml bottle. At the other end of the scale, the most expensive bottles are around $499, like Moët & Chandon MCIII.

How many drinks do you get out of a 750ML bottle?
16 drinks
Liquor: Mixed drinks have a 1.5-ounce (45 ml) serving of liquor per drink, so a 750-ml bottle will make about 16 drinks.

How many shots are in a 750ml whiskey?
16 shots
Liquor Shots per Bottle
How Many Shots Are in a Bottle? | ||
---|---|---|
Bottle | Milliliters | Shots per Bottle |
Standard Bottle (aka Fifth) | 750 ml | 16 shots |
Liter | 1 L | 22 shots |
Magnum | 1.5 L | 33 shots |
How do you drink Brut Champagne?
What Temperature Should You Serve Brut? Brut should be served the same as any other sparkling wine or Champagne: nice and cold. To enjoy at the best temperature, leave your bottle of bubbly in the fridge for at least three hours. If you’re running short on time, pop it in an ice bucket filled with ice and water.
